Colleen Garrett

November 27, 1951 - December 7, 2020

Colleen Jane Holtman Garrett, aged 69, passed away on December 7, 2020 after a short and fierce battle with cancer. We were privileged to know her as Mom, Grandma, Sweetheart, Sister, Aunt, and dear Friend. She married her eternal sweetheart, Reg Garrett, on September 18, 1970 in the Salt Lake Temple. She loved her morning walks and bike rides throughout the years with many close friends in Alpine. She also loved to travel with family and friends to any destination where she could walk on the beach and watch the sun rise. She taught us the value of hard work through example and extremely lengthy chore lists she wrote for us on a daily basis. In her later years she would love to laugh as we still tried to complain about that. When her youngest child started school, she wasted no time jumping in to help pay the bills by working part time at the State Developmental Center. Twenty-seven years later she retired from the State Hospital and was “discharged from the Insane Asylum of the Territory of Utah having had her sanity restored.” Another joy in her life was her relationship with the Savior. She honored that relationship by serving and loving everyone around her. We can’t think of a better way to describe our mom than how she lived Mosiah 18:9: “...willing to mourn with those that mourn; yea, and comfort those that stand in need of comfort, and to stand as witnesses of God at all times and in all things, and in all places that ye may be in, even until death...” Her family was the most important thing in her life. She showed this in countless ways. Throughout her entire life she looked after her 5 sisters. As her parents aged, she lovingly cared for them. She raised her 6 children without a single complaint (that we know of) and was actively involved in the lives of all 20 grandchildren. She loved planning our next adventure, and looked for any opportunity to spend time with her family. We always looked forward to tacos on the farm, Thanksgiving mashed potatoes and the annual Garrett Christmas Eve soup bowl and Nativity celebration. Mom loved us through all of our mistakes and faults. She accepted our weaknesses. She comforted us during our worst days. She was the first to celebrate our successes and was always encouraging us to do our best. She loved us unconditionally and without fail. She was literally the best mom we could have ever asked for. She will be missed every single day. Colleen is survived by the love of her life, Reg and her 6, incredibly beautiful and talented children: Cody (Diana), Casey (taking applicants), Nikki (Dallas), Ashli (Deven), Cade (Emily), Reggie (Jessica), her 20 grandchildren, Jerrie (Lynn) Hurst, Jody Murray, Joni (Robert) Jensen, Teresa Wu, Amy (Corey) Solum, Ralph Garrett, Ray (Milli) Garrett, David (Coy) Garrett, Debbie (Mike) Phillips, Denece (John) Jones and Carmen (Vernon) Lujan.
